Futur-Tek logo in a gray background | Futur-TekFutur-Tek has introduced a line of vases that can be added to a number of surfaces to brighten up everyday places. Heart Vases and Bud Vases can be used to decorate wine, gift-wrapped presents and boxed chocolates, giving retailers an opportunity to boost sales in these segments. The Heart Vase is a ceramic, heart-shaped mini-flower vase that is designed to both hide the peel-and-stick velcro-like hook-and-loop fasteners that allow it to stick to most vertical and horizontal surfaces. In addition to wine bottles, gift-wrapped presents and boxed chocolates, the vases can be added to computers, dashboards and file cabinets, as well as mirrors, patio doors and the fridge. “I first came up with the idea when I thought how nice it would be to enjoy flowers on my dashboard," said Tom Kahan, president of Futur-Tek. "With peel-and-stick velcro, they can attach and reattach easily almost anywhere.” The Heart Vases are available in a variety of messages, including Love You, Friends Forever, Happy Birthday, God Bless This Baby, Home Sweet Home and more. Heart and Bud Vases are available with a white or red silk rose or just solo, so the vase can be filled with fresh or other silk flowers by customers and/or people receiving the vase as a gift. The vases are also available in gift boxes with a blank greeting card inside. Together, they make a gift and card ensemble that’s easy to send and even fun to give in person, according to the company. The boxed vases go on a POP carousel designed to hold all 18 Heart Vase, both styles of Angel Hearts. For retailers, Futur-Tek offers signage that can also show how its Heart Vase brighten customers' favorite brands of wine, wrapping paper and boxed chocolates, while directing customers in those sections  to a retailer's greeting card and/or floral departments to see the full selection and/or pick out a favorite mini-bouquet.
